Complete guide

Ambiance & landscapes

Bophut, Choeng Mon and Bangrak form a harmonious ensemble on Koh Samui's north-east coast. Light-sand beaches border shallow, translucent waters ideal for swimming. Bophut's Fisherman's Village retains its historic charm with colourful boutiques and seafront restaurants. Choeng Mon stands out with its five-star hotels nestled in lush vegetation, offering breathtaking gulf views. Bangrak presents calmer coves and spectacular sunsets over Ko Som island. The atmosphere remains serene even in high season thanks to controlled development that preserves palms and mangroves. Sea breezes cool the tropical air while sky colours shift from deep blue to orange-pink at dusk.

Things to see and do

Stroll along Bophut's historic pier to admire traditional boats and photograph stilt houses. Visit the nearby Big Buddha at Bangrak, a 12-metre golden statue accessible via a staircase lined with shops. Explore Choeng Mon beach for paddleboarding or snorkelling in clear waters. Taste fresh fruit at Bophut's morning market then attend a Thai cooking class. Hire a scooter to reach nearby Namuang waterfall or take a boat trip to Ang Thong archipelago islands. Watch a Thai boxing match at nearby Chaweng stadium.

Where to eat and drink

Bophut restaurants offer fresh pad Thai and grilled seafood caught locally. Try green curry with coconut milk or spicy som tam at small Fisherman's Village establishments. At Choeng Mon, resorts serve refined brunches with mango and papaya. Bangrak shelters beachside bars where cocktails made with local rum can be enjoyed at sunset. Specialities include steamed ginger fish and prawns marinated in satay sauce.

Transport & access

Koh Samui international airport lies just fifteen minutes by taxi from Bangrak. Private shuttles and minivans serve all three areas regularly from Nathon port. Scooter hire remains the most practical way to travel between Bophut and Choeng Mon. Taxis and apps such as Grab enable comfortable short journeys. Ferries from the mainland dock nearby and taxis await arrivals. Traffic stays fluid outside peak hours.

Who is it for?

This area suits honeymoon couples seeking romantic resorts and tranquil beaches. Affluent families appreciate spacious villas with private pools and child-friendly activities. Local gastronomy enthusiasts enjoy numerous quality restaurants. Travellers seeking authenticity appreciate Bophut's fishing village and preserved atmosphere away from Chaweng crowds.
